Visitor Policy — Landlord Site Audit

Night-shift note: representatives of Harrowgate Estates, our landlord, will conduct a site audit on Thursday night between 23:00 and 02:00. They must sign the after-hours register, wear the orange visitor lanyards, and remain escorted at all times, including in plant rooms. Photograph nothing yourself; the auditors carry their own documentation kit. Confirm identities against the list in the night folder before admitting anyone. Admit them through the service entrance using the pass below.

door code, yagap-bahof: bdg-O-05

To the release manager: I'm passing ownership of the Pellwick deep-link router to Sorrel before the 4.2 cut. The intent-matching table now lives in the Farrowgate config service; stale entries were purged last sprint. Watch the fallback route — it silently swallows malformed slugs, which inflated our drop-off metrics in March. The staging resolver needs its keystore unlocked before each regression pass, and that keystore accepts only one credential. For the signing vault, the recovery phrase is noted directly below.

recovery phrase for tafog-fafog: novix-novdor-fraath-brieth-olieth-oliix-rusix-wenion-julax-druox

// Plugin authors: this constant pins the Verdigris schema
// registry version your event payloads are validated against.
// Do not emit events against an older schema; the registry
// rejects them at ingest, no retries. Breaking changes land
// only on major bumps. Check compatibility with the `vgr check`
// tool before publishing. If validation fails locally, update
// your generated bindings first. Registry snapshots are keyed
// by the trace token that appears below.

build token for hadup-kagag: htk3_a67

14:22 — Diff viewer falls over on the big ones

Around 14:22, Pellwick's diff viewer started timing out on files over 40k lines. Turns out the new syntax-highlight pass ran on the full buffer before chunking, so the worker pegged a core and the reviewer UI just spun. We rolled back the highlight change at 14:51 and queues drained. The rollback artifact's token is recorded below.

build token for tawip-yageg: htk9_92ac43d42